Meeting Guests vs Potential Members
Ann Fitch
We love having our Members bring guests to meetings. If you have a friend or colleague that is interested in one of our programs, please bring them without hesitation! If you have someone that you would like to propose for Membership, that is a little different procedure. Our Club is going to get back to the practice of letting the Rotarians object or approve a potential member. For those of you that are newer, historically, the Club gets an email with the name of the person that is being recommended for membership and each member gets to object (in writing) or give no response for approval. It has been about two years since we have actually practiced this.
If you have someone that you would like to bring to a meeting with the purpose of asking them to join, please submit that name to Penny Vought, the Membership Chair, prior to inviting them to the meeting. This will give our membership the opportunity to object or approve. We are doing this early on in the courtship, because we do not want individuals to come to a meeting with the hopes of joining, get excited to be a part of our Club, and THEN possibly have a member object to them. We want to avoid someone saying, "Rotary didn't want me." That is simply not a lens that we want to be seen through.
You may wonder, "why would any member object to someone joining?" There are a number of reasons, it may be a question of integrity, safety, or any other reason. We trust that our Members would not use trivial differences as a reason to object. Please reach out to me if you have any questions on this, I am happy to clarify or expound.
